AFRM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2021 in Review

338 of the 5,712 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Affirm (AFRM) for Q3 2021, worth a combined $13.2B — up 120% from $6.01B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 151 funds opened new AFRM positions and 39 closed out — a net gain of 112 holders — while 78 added to existing stakes and 71 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$806M. The largest seller was Thrive Capital Management (New York), exiting entirely with an estimated $265M sold.
